If you’re used to traveling with amenities like showers, laundry, and sometimes even fireplaces, a Class A motorhome is going to suit you well. If you want to travel lighter, and with just one or two other people, a Class B campervan might be more your style - the smaller size means it’s easier to maneuver and you can camp just about anywhere. A Class C camper is the perfect blend of both of those classes - larger than a campervan, but with some of the amenities of a Class A motorhome. RVshare also has 5th wheel trailers, teardrop campers, toy haulers, and a variety of campers and trailers to rent.

Explore Poplar Bluff, MO

If you want to explore Poplar Bluff, Missouri, with friends or family, renting an RV from RVShare offers a cost-efficient and comfortable way to travel together.Poplar Bluff, Missouri, is a small city that offers a variety of exciting sights and activities. If you're traveling to the area in an RV, there are several places you should consider visiting.Margaret Harwell Art Museum – This museum houses an impressive art collection from local and regional artists. The famous site has been around since 1961 and features work from artists such as Thomas Hart Benton and Andy Warhol.Mo-Ark Regional Railroad Museum – Located in the historic Poplar Bluff Railroad Depot, this museum showcases the history of railroads in southeast Missouri and northeast Arkansas. You'll find exhibits on train cars, engines, and a model train display.Poplar Bluff Museum – This museum offers a glimpse into the city's past with exhibits on local history, including artifacts from the Civil War era. The building is over 100 years old and was used as a hospital during the Spanish-American War.In addition to these museums, Poplar Bluff boasts scenic parks such as Lake Wappapello State Park, where you can hike, bike along several trails, or enjoy water activities like swimming or fishing. And if you're looking for outdoor fun, head to Hydro Adventures Water Park for thrilling water rides.

Best National Parks Near Poplar Bluff, MO

Mammoth Cave National Park, located about four hours from Poplar Bluff, boasts the world's longest-known cave system. The park provides a range of outdoor activities, such as hiking and camping, including the Green River Bluffs Trail. However, RV hookups are not available at this national park.Hot Springs National Park in Garland County, Arkansas, is approximately three hours from Poplar Bluff. Established in 1832 as a reservation to protect hot springs flowing from Hot Springs Mountain, it became a national park in 1921. Visitors can take a guided tour of the historic Fordyce Bathhouse or hike some 26 miles (42 km) of trails. Although there are no RV hookups at this national park, visitors can reserve camping spots nearby Lake Catherine State Park.Gateway Arch National Park is about two and a half hours from Poplar Bluff in St. Louis, Missouri. This urban national park was established in 2018 and covered 91 acres along the Mississippi River, where visitors can learn about St. Louis's history and western expansion in America. Unfortunately, there are no RV campsites or other visitor facilities within this national park.Whether you're interested in exploring underground caves or enjoying scenic hikes along river bluffs, these national parks near Poplar Bluff offer plenty of opportunities for adventure and discovery on your next RV trip!

Popular State Parks Near Poplar Bluff, MO

Taum Sauk Mountain State Park is a must-visit destination for RVers traveling to Poplar Bluff. Established in 1991, this park covers an area of 8732.23 acres. The area offers several trails with varying difficulty levels for hikers and bikers. The Mina Sauk Falls Trail, which leads to Missouri's highest waterfall, is popular among tourists.Reelfoot Lake State Park is a perfect place for fishing enthusiasts. The park has numerous fishing piers and boat ramps available for visitors. Several hiking trails lead through the scenic beauty of the Reelfoot Lake area.Davidsonville Historic State Park is an excellent option for history buffs visiting Poplar Bluff. This state park was once a town inhabited by settlers in the early 19th century and now serves as a historic site with various exhibits showcasing the life of those times. There are also camping sites available at this park for RVers looking to spend the night.Johnson's Shut-Ins State Park is another excellent choice for cooling off during hot summer days. This area features natural water slides formed by shut-ins, which create small pools of water that allow visitors to swim and relax amidst breathtaking natural beauty.Plenty of state parks near Poplar Bluff offer exciting activities and beautiful scenery for RVers traveling through Missouri.

RVshare’s Top Picks for Nearby RV Parks & Campgrounds

Camelot RV Campground offers 76 full hookup sites with back-in and pull-through options and amenities such as showers, Wi-Fi, and cell reception. They also offer discounts to members of various clubs or organizations.Reynolds Park has 11 full hookup sites with big rig access and various facilities like restrooms, lake access, grills, and more. Seniors can enjoy a discounted daily rate when visiting.Big Creek RV Park has 65 full hookup sites with a pool and hot tub. They offer Good Sam Club members, military personnel, and seniors discounts.Crowley's Ridge State Park offers 18 RV sites with electric or water hookups. Visitors can enjoy activities like swimming, horse riding, boat rental, and more. Tent camping is also available for those who prefer it.

Frequently Asked Questions About Renting an RV Near Poplar Bluff, MO

How much does it cost to rent an RV in Poplar Bluff?

Motorhomes are divided into Class A, B, and C vehicles. On average expect to pay $185 per night for Class A, $149 per night for Class B and $179 per night for Class C. Towable RVs include 5th Wheel, Travel Trailers, Popups, and Toy Hauler. On average, in Poplar Bluff, MO, the 5th Wheel trailer starts at $70 per night. Pricing for the Travel Trailer begins at $60 per night, and the Popup Trailer starts at $65 per night.

Do you need to be a certain age to rent an RV in Poplar Bluff?

Yes. The minimum age is 25 to be eligible to get an RV Rental in Poplar Bluff from RVshare.
